China News Service, Tianjin, November 1 (Reporter Zhang Daozheng) A reporter from China News Service learned from the official information of Tianjin Binhai New Area on the evening of November 1 that one person who lost contact in the collapse of the South Ring Railway Bridge has been found and has no vital signs.

The rescue at the scene of the accident was basically over, and the accident caused 7 deaths and 5 injuries.

The person in charge of the construction site of the collapse accident has been controlled by the public security organs.

  Comprehensive data show that on the morning of November 1, Tianjin Nanhuan Railway Maintenance Co., Ltd. occurred in the process of bridge maintenance on the Nanhuan Railway.

After the accident, Tianjin City immediately organized public security, fire control, emergency response, health and other related departments to carry out emergency rescue at the scene.

192 people from the local fire rescue force rushed to the scene with 10 search and rescue dogs.

  After receiving the report, Li Hongzhong, secretary of the Tianjin Municipal Party Committee, and Liao Guoxun, deputy secretary of the Municipal Party Committee and Mayor, immediately gave instructions and went to the scene to direct the rescue and disposal of the accident.

  As of about 18:00 on November 1, a missing person from the collapse of the South Ring Railway Bridge has been found and has no vital signs.

The rescue at the scene of the accident was basically over, and the accident caused 7 deaths and 5 injuries.

  It is understood that the accident occurred when the Nanhuan Railway Maintenance Co., Ltd. was replacing the bridge sleepers at K4+300 meters of the Lingang Railway.
